The ECU/PCS AIG camp is an annual summer camp for Pitt County AIG students. This camp began in 2005 and has grown each year. We will host 120 gifted students this summer. Along with Pitt County Schools master teachers, ECU faculty and students will offer a week of rigorous enrichment for your student.
This year, PCS students who are identified as gifted and are currently in grades 4 through 8 are invited to apply to the ECU/PCS AIG summer camp during the week of July 16-19 from 7:45 am–noon Monday-Wednesday and on Thursday from 7:45am-5:00pm. The fee is $125 per child and a few need-based scholarships are available this summer. Families are also invited to sponsor a child who has a demonstrated financial need.
This summer’s curriculum theme is SYSTEMS. Whether the students are learning about underwater treasures, the body’s mechanical systems, or insects and animals they will be investigating the relationship of systems to our world.
Following an opening morning session, students will participate in systems-themed stations. Students will be able to select topics that match their interests and all topics will include hands-on activities and interactive use of technology. Snacks will be served daily.
